Agnes, who was a homemaker, was predeceased by her husband, John R., and a daughter, Barbara Nammar Cippolone.
She worked for 20 years at Grablick's Ice Cream Parlor, Pittston. As a communicant of St. Casmir's Church, Pittston, she was a member of the church choir. She also had been a member of the Pittston Senior Citizens.
Surviving are a son, John R., Pittston; three daughters, Rosemary R. Sheenan, Dunellen, N.J.; Katherine Ceschan, Phoenixville; and Deborah Snitzer, Jersey City, N.J.; eight grandchildren; and seven great-grandchildren.
Visiting hours will be held from 5 to 8 p.m. Wednesday at Kizis-Lokuta Funeral Home, 134 Church St., Pittston. A Mass of Christian Burial will be held at 9:30 a.m. Thursday at St. John the Evangelist Church, Pittston. Interment will be in St. Casmir's Cemetery, Pittston.
